Deleting a profile Instagram forever is an irreversible process that erases all your publications, stories, messages and data from the system. Many users Android encounter difficulties in finding this function, since it is hidden deep in the application settings. Unlike temporary deactivation, complete deletion requires confirmation via email and a waiting period of up to 30 days, during which the account can be restored.
It is worth noting that the deletion procedure through the mobile application differs from the web version. In this article we will focus specifically on step-by-step guide for Android, taking into account the features of the latest versions of the application. You will learn not only how to find the desired section, but also what to do if the delete button is inactive, how to confirm the action via email and what data will be lost forever.
Before starting the process, make sure that you have saved all important information: photos, videos, correspondence. Instagram does not provide a function for directly exporting data through a mobile application - for this you will need to use the web version. Also remember that after deleting, your username will become available for registration by other people after 14 days, and all analytics and statistics (if you had a business account) will be irretrievably lost.

Step-by-step guide: how to find the deletion section in the application
Starting in 2026, Instagram moved the account deletion function deeper into the settings, which caused confusion among many users. Here exact path for the latest versions of the application on Android:
- Open the application Instagram and go to your profile (person icon in the lower right corner).
- Click on the three horizontal lines (โฐ) in the upper right corner, then select
Settings and Privacy. - Scroll down to the section
Accountand click on it. - Select
Account information center(previously this section was called "Help"). - Tap on
Account management, thenDelete account.
If you do not see the item "Delete account", your version of the application may be outdated. Update Instagram via Google Play or clear the application cache in the phone settings (Settings โ Applications โ Instagram โ Storage โ Clear cache).
What what to do if the "Delete account" section is missing?
In some regions (for example, in the EU), due to data protection laws, the path may differ. Try an alternative route: Settings โ Privacy โ Account โ Delete account. If this does not work, use the browser on your phone and follow the direct link https://www.instagram.com/accounts/remove/request/permanent/

What happens after confirmation of deletion
After clicking on the confirmation link in the letter, 30-day waiting periodAt this time:
- ๐ค Your profile becomes invisible to other users
- ๐ธ All publications, stories and comments are hidden
- ๐ฌ Messages in Direct remain with the recipients, but your name is replaced with "Instagram User"
- ๐ Your account does not appear in searches and recommendations
During these 30 days, you can cancel deletionby simply logging into your account through the app or web version. After the deadline, all data will be irretrievably deleted, including:

If you used Instagram to log into other services (for example Facebook, Spotify or games), after deleting your account, these applications may block access. In advance change the authorization method to email or phone in the settings of these services.
Even after deleting your account, your data can remain in Instagram backups for up to 90 days. Complete erasure from the servers takes up to 3 months, according to the Meta privacy policy.

Account recovery after deletion: capabilities and limitations
You can restore your account only within 30 days after confirming the deletion. To do this:
- Open the application Instagram or go to the website.
- Enter the login and password for the deleted account.
- Click "Cancel deletion" in the notification that appears.
If 30 days have expired, restoration impossibleThe only option is. create a new account with a different username. In this case:
- ๐ Your old username (@nickname) may be taken
- ๐ง Email linked to a deleted account can be used again
- ๐ Phone number released 30 days after deletion

FAQ: answers to frequently asked questions
Is it possible to delete an Instagram account without access to email?
No, confirmation via email is required. If you have lost access to your email:
- Try to restore access to your email through the mail service support service.
- If your email cannot be restored, change it in the Instagram settings (
Settings โ Personal information โ Email) to the current address before the deletion procedure begins.
Without email confirmation, the account will not be deleted, even if you go through all the steps in the application.

How long does it take to completely delete an account from the servers?
The process occurs in three stages:
- 30 days โthe period when you can cancel the deletion. The account is hidden, but the data is saved.
- Up to 90 days โafter confirmation, the data is gradually deleted from the servers (according to the Meta privacy policy).
- Up to 180 days โbackups can be stored in the company archives.
This means that even after 30 days, your data may physically remain on the servers, but will not be viewable.

What to do if, when deleting, it says โYour account does not meet the requirementsโ?
This message appears in several cases:
- ๐ Account was created less than 24 hours ago.
- ๐ You have already submitted a deletion request and canceled it within the last 7 days.
- ๐ซ The account has been blocked for violating community rules (deletion is not possible until unblocked).
- ๐ฑ You are using an unofficial version of the application (for example, a modified APK).
Solution: wait 24 hours and try again. If the problem persists, check your account status in Settings โ Account โ Account status.
